**Mgmt Meeting Minutes — Retiring the Brightline Range**

Quick recap for sales leads at Fenholt Supplies: we agreed to retire the Brightline fixture range by year-end. Remaining stock moves to clearance pricing next month, and accounts on standing orders get migrated to the Lumetta range. Trade-in incentives were approved in principle. The confidential note on next steps sits just below.

board note of bajof-bajeg: The pricing group signed off on a budget of $13.4 million for Project Sildor. The renewal with Lamixek Holdings closes at $48.9 million a year, 49 percent above the last contract.

Handover note — Crumbwheel order cutoffs.

Welcome aboard. The bakery cutoff rule in Crumbwheel closes same-day orders at 14:00 local to each storefront, not UTC — this has bitten us twice. Holiday overrides live in the calendar service and take precedence silently, so always check there first when a cutoff looks wrong. To unlock the calendar service's admin console after a restart, enter the recovery passphrase below.

vault phrase of bagap-bahaf = silion-pelox-sorox-casdor-quenwyn-fraax-eliox-praael-kelion-quenvan-kasox-rusael-norius-belvan

// Client setup for the Splitgrove assignment service.
// Plugin authors: assignments are resolved server-side; do not cache
// variant results locally for longer than the session. The client
// retries twice on timeout, then falls back to the control arm.
// Initialize against the sandbox endpoint first and verify your
// experiment slug resolves. Authenticate the client with the key below.

service key, hawif-kadup: vxb7-VMYtoba

Fan-out backpressure for the Quillet notifier: when the queue depth crosses the soft limit, the dispatcher sheds low-priority pushes and batches the rest at 500ms intervals. Reviewer should confirm the shed counter is exported and that retries respect the jitter window. Once merged, the release artifact gets re-signed by the pipeline, which expects the deploy key shown below.

deploy key for bawep-yawif: bky6_GQhaSt